dev-haskell/haskell-language-server (haskell)

Search

Package Information

Description:
LSP server for GHC
Homepage:
https://github.com/haskell/haskell-language-server#readme
License:
Apache-2.0

Versions

Version EAPI Keywords Slot
2.9.0.1 8 ~amd64 0/2.9.0.1
2.6.0.0 8 ~amd64 0/2.6.0.0
2.10.0.0 8 ~amd64 0/2.10.0.0

Metadata

Maintainers

Upstream

Raw Metadata XML
<pkgmetadata>
	<maintainer type="project">
		<email>haskell@gentoo.org</email>
		<name>Gentoo Haskell</name>
	</maintainer>
	<use>
		<flag name="ghcide-bench">Build the ghcide-bench executable</flag>
		<flag name="ghcide-bench-lib">Build the ghcide-bench-lib library</flag>
		<flag name="hls_plugins_alternate-number-format">Enable Alternate Number Format plugin</flag>
		<flag name="hls_plugins_cabal">Enable cabal plugin</flag>
		<flag name="hls_plugins_cabal-fmt">Enable cabalfmt plugin</flag>
		<flag name="hls_plugins_cabal-gild">Enable cabalgild plugin</flag>
		<flag name="hls_plugins_call-hierarchy">Enable callHierarchy plugin</flag>
		<flag name="hls_plugins_change-type-signature">Change a declarations type signature with a Code Action</flag>
		<flag name="hls_plugins_class">Enable class plugin</flag>
		<flag name="hls_plugins_code-range">Enable codeRange plugin</flag>
		<flag name="hls_plugins_eval">Enable eval plugin</flag>
		<flag name="hls_plugins_explicit-fields">Enable explicit-fields plugin</flag>
		<flag name="hls_plugins_explicit-fixity">Enable explicit-fixity plugin</flag>
		<flag name="hls_plugins_floskell">Enable floskell plugin</flag>
		<flag name="hls_plugins_gadt">Enable GADT plugin</flag>
		<flag name="hls_plugins_hlint">Enable hlint plugin</flag>
		<flag name="hls_plugins_import-lens">Enable importLens plugin</flag>
		<flag name="hls_plugins_module-name">Enable moduleName plugin</flag>
		<flag name="hls_plugins_notes">Enable notes plugin</flag>
		<flag name="hls_plugins_overloaded-record-dot">Enable overloadedRecordDot plugin</flag>
		<flag name="hls_plugins_pragmas">Enable pragmas plugin</flag>
		<flag name="hls_plugins_qualify-imported-names">Enable qualifyImportedNames plugin</flag>
		<flag name="hls_plugins_refactor">Enable refactor plugin</flag>
		<flag name="hls_plugins_rename">Enable rename plugin</flag>
		<flag name="hls_plugins_retrie">Enable retrie plugin</flag>
		<flag name="hls_plugins_semantic-tokens">Enable semanticTokens plugin</flag>
		<flag name="hls_plugins_splice">Enable splice plugin</flag>
		<flag name="hls_plugins_stylish-haskell">Enable stylishHaskell plugin</flag>
		<flag name="ghcide-test-exe">Build the ghcide-test-preprocessor executable</flag>
	</use>
	<upstream>
		<remote-id type="hackage">haskell-language-server</remote-id>
		<remote-id type="github">haskell/haskell-language-server</remote-id>
	</upstream>
</pkgmetadata>

Lint Warnings

USE Flags

Flag Description 2.9.0.1 2.6.0.0 2.10.0.0
ghcide-bench Build the ghcide-bench executable
ghcide-bench-lib Build the ghcide-bench-lib library
ghcide-test-exe Build the ghcide-test-preprocessor executable
hls_plugins_alternate-number-format Enable Alternate Number Format plugin
hls_plugins_cabal Enable cabal plugin
hls_plugins_cabal-fmt Enable cabalfmt plugin
hls_plugins_cabal-gild Enable cabalgild plugin
hls_plugins_call-hierarchy Enable callHierarchy plugin
hls_plugins_change-type-signature Change a declarations type signature with a Code Action
hls_plugins_class Enable class plugin
hls_plugins_code-range Enable codeRange plugin
hls_plugins_eval Enable eval plugin
hls_plugins_explicit-fields Enable explicit-fields plugin
hls_plugins_explicit-fixity Enable explicit-fixity plugin
hls_plugins_floskell Enable floskell plugin
hls_plugins_gadt Enable GADT plugin
hls_plugins_hlint Enable hlint plugin
hls_plugins_import-lens Enable importLens plugin
hls_plugins_module-name Enable moduleName plugin
hls_plugins_notes Enable notes plugin
hls_plugins_overloaded-record-dot Enable overloadedRecordDot plugin
hls_plugins_pragmas Enable pragmas plugin
hls_plugins_qualify-imported-names Enable qualifyImportedNames plugin
hls_plugins_refactor Enable refactor plugin
hls_plugins_rename Enable rename plugin
hls_plugins_retrie Enable retrie plugin
hls_plugins_semantic-tokens Enable semanticTokens plugin
hls_plugins_splice Enable splice plugin
hls_plugins_stylish-haskell Enable stylishHaskell plugin

Files

Manifest

Type File Size Versions
Unmatched Entries
Type File Size
DIST haskell-language-server-2.10.0.0.tar.gz 536724 bytes
DIST haskell-language-server-2.6.0.0.tar.gz 80146 bytes
DIST haskell-language-server-2.9.0.1.tar.gz 492999 bytes